Peroxide-crosslinkable compositions and processes for their manufacture
A peroxide-crosslinkable composition comprising: (A) A peroxide-crosslinkable polymer, e.g., a polyethylene; (B) A nitrogenous base, e.g., a low molecular weight, or low melting, or liquid nitrogenous base such as triallyl cyanurate (TAC); and (C) One or more antioxidants (AO), e.g., distearylthiodipropionate (DSTDP). The composition is useful in the manufacture of insulation sheaths for high and extra high voltage wire and cable.

COMMUNICATION CABLE AND WIRE HARNESS USING SAME
A communication cable includes an insulation electric wire including a conductor having tensile strength of 400 MPa or more and a cross-sectional area of 0.22 mm.sup.2 or less and a covering layer covering the conductor and being formed of an insulating material, and a sheath covering an outer periphery of the insulation electric wire and being formed of a resin composition containing crystalline polyolefin. A tensile elastic modulus of the sheath is 500 MPa or less, and a mass increase rate of the sheath is less than 50 mass % in a plasticizer migration test involving exposure in an atmosphere at 105? C. for 3,000 hours. Characteristic impedance of the communication cable is 100?10?.

Rectangular insulated wire, coil and electrical and electronic device
A rectangular insulated wire includes a rectangular conductor having a generally rectangular cross section and a plurality of baked-coating resin layers disposed to cover the rectangular conductor. Each of the plurality of baked-coating resin layers is formed of at least one resin selected from a group comprising a polyester-based resin including a trihydric or tetrahydric alcohol constituent, a polyester imide resin, a polyamide-imide resin and a polyimide resin. An adhesion strength between the plurality of baked-coating resin layers is greater than or equal to 5 g/mm and less than or equal to 10 g/mm.
ELECTRICAL CABLE HAVING CROSSLINKED INSULATION WITH INTERNAL PULLING LUBRICANT
Electrical power cable having a reduced surface coefficient of friction and required installation pulling force, and the method of manufacture thereof, in which the central conductor core, with or without a separate insulating layer, is surrounded by a sheath of crosslinked polyethylene. A high viscosity, high molecular weight silicone based pulling lubricant or fatty acid amide pulling lubricant is incorporated by alternate methods with the polyethylene to form a composition from which the outer sheath is extruded, and is effective to reduce the required pulling force on the cable during installation.

SELF-FUSING INSULATED WIRE, COIL AND ELECTRICAL/ELECTRONIC EQUIPMENT
A self-fusing insulated wire, containing: a conductor having a rectangular cross-section; a thermoplastic resin layer provided on the outer periphery of the conductor; and a thermosetting fusing layer provided on the outer periphery of the thermoplastic resin layer;
wherein the fusing layer is composed of a hardening resin composition having an epoxy-group-containing phenoxy resin (a1), an epoxy resin (a2) having a softening point of 50 C. or more and 250 C. or less, and an imidazole-series hardening agent,
wherein, in the hardening resin composition, a content ratio of the resin (a1) and the resin (a2) satisfies the relationship of (a1):(a2)=71:29 to 95:5 (mass ratio), and a content of the imidazole-series hardening agent with respect to 100 parts by mass of a total content of the resin (a1) and the resin (a2) is less than 2 parts by mass, and
wherein a storage elastic modulus at 85 C. of the hardening resin composition after hardening thereof is from 100 to 2,500 MPa.
